Nissan Versa (N17): B2557 Vehicle speed

Nissan Versa 2nd generation (N17) Service Manual / Body exterior, doors, roof & vehicle security / Security control system (SEC) / B2557 Vehicle speed

DTC Logic

DTC DETECTION LOGIC

NOTE:

  • If DTC B2557 is displayed with DTC U1000, first perform the trouble diagnosis for DTC U1000. Refer to BCS "DTC Logic".
  • If DTC B2557 is displayed with DTC U1010, first perform the trouble diagnosis for DTC U1010. Refer to BCS "DTC Logic".       

DTC CONFIRMATION PROCEDURE

1.PERFORM DTC CONFIRMATION PROCEDURE

1. Start engine and wait 10 seconds or more.

2. Drive the vehicle at a vehicle speed of 10 km/h (6.2 MPH) or more for 10 seconds or more.

3. Check DTC in Self Diagnostic Result mode of BCM using CONSULT.

Is DTC detected?

YES >> Go to SEC "Diagnosis Procedure".

NO >> Inspection End.

Diagnosis Procedure

1.CHECK DTC OF "ABS ACTUATOR AND ELECTRIC UNIT (CONTROL UNIT)"

Check DTC in Self Diagnostic Result mode of ABS using CONSULT.

Is DTC detected?

YES >> Perform the trouble diagnosis related to the detected DTC. Refer to BRC "DTC Index".

NO >> GO TO 2.

2.CHECK DTC OF COMBINATION METER

Check DTC in Self Diagnostic Result mode of METER/M&A using CONSULT.

Is DTC detected?

YES >> Perform the trouble diagnosis related to the detected DTC. Refer to MWI "DTC Index".

NO >> GO TO 3.

3.CHECK INTERMITTENT INCIDENT

Refer to GI "Intermittent Incident".

>> Inspection End.
